The relationship between dislocations and disclinations

Pages 1499-1508 | Received 25 Jan 1977, Accepted 22 May 1977, Published online: 13 Sep 2006
 

Abstract

The methods of differential geometry have been applied to the Burgers circuit taken about a wedge diaclination. It is shown that both the torsion tensor as well as the Riemann-Christoffel curvature tensor are necessary in order to describe completely the closure failure associated with such a circuit. In particular, both tensors measure the dislocation contribution associated with the disclination.
